Health Minister Dr. Rajiv Saizal presides over closing ceremony of 5th phase of Jan Bhagidari se Sushasan- Himachal ka Maha Quiz

Health and Family Welfare and AYUSH Minister Dr. Rajiv Saizal presided over the concluding ceremony of the 5th phase of the "Jan Bhagidari se Sushasan- Himachal ka Maha Quiz" being organized by the State Government here today. "Healthy Himachal – Prosperous Himachal" was the theme of the 5th phase of the Maha Quiz held online from 28th June to 12th July 2022.

 On this occasion, Dr. Rajiv Saizal exhorted the citizens to ensure their participation in good governance. He said that during the tenure of the present government, a new era of public welfare has started in the state. He said that 8568 people participated in the 5th phase. In this phase 2308 participants answered questions in English and 6260 participants in Hindi language. 

So far a total 71455 participants have participated in this Maha Quiz which started on 11th May 2022. The Health Minister while congratulating all the participants said that 235 participants who performed best in the 5th phase would be given prize money of Rs 1,000 each.

He also detailed the various schemes being implemented by the state government in the health sector. He said that 6.18 lac families were registered in HIMCARE Scheme and 3.08 lac people have been benefited by spending Rs. 285.35 crore under the scheme. Under the Mukhyamantri Sahara Yojana, an assistance of about Rs 80 crore has been provided to about 20,000 beneficiaries, he added.

The Health Minister presented prize money to the winners of the 5th phase through Direct Benefit Transfer and presented a cheque of prize money to the winners present in the function. He also interacted with the participants of Maha Quiz through video conferencing.

Hem Raj Bairwa, Director National Health Mission, welcomed the Health Minister and other dignitaries and detailed the Maha Quiz.Director Health and Family Welfare Dr. Anita Mahajan presented a vote of thanks.A short documentary film based on Maha Quiz was also screened on the occasion.

Himachal ka Maha Quiz has a total 8 phases and 5 phases have been completed. Interested persons can win cash prizes by participating in the remaining 3 phases. For this they have to register free on MyGov Himachal portal. In each phase, 10 questions based on Central and State Government schemes will be asked in Hindi and English language to be answered in two minutes and 30 seconds.
